The period for nominations of the NZPFU Local Triennial elections closed at 5pm yesterday (Thursday 29 May).    

Please see the notices available for download below for every NZPFU Local detailing the nominations, those elected unopposed and where elections will need to be conducted.    

Northern Branch

Central Branch

Southern Branch

Elected Unopposed:

  • Congratulations to those elected to their Local Secretary, President, Vice President and Committees unopposed.
  • In accordance with the Rules, you will take up your position as of 1 August 2025.   
  • In the interim, the current Local officials and committees remain.

Elections:

  • We will be conducting elections in Locals where the number of nominations exceed the positions in accordance with the NZPFU Rules.
  • Members of the Locals where elections will be held will be shortly informed of the process for those elections, including the order of those elections if more than one has to be held in that Local.
  • If anyone is considering withdrawing their nomination, we ask that you do so promptly as the withdrawal may affect an election or the order of elections.

AUCKLAND HEAVY AERIAL – PARNELL 255

Members will be aware of District Manager Mackereth's instruction to all staff to restrict Parnell’s aerial appliance to respond to confirmed fires only, copied below.

This instruction was issued without genuine consultation with the Auckland Local and highlights the disarray and crisis that Fire and Emergencies fleet is in. Despite the organisation saying that their fleet is well maintained and regularly serviced, once again reality proves the complete opposite,  with this decision impacting the safety and well-being of firefighters and the public.
